FROM 1997. ty 17:48 #888 P.14/24 <br /> February 14. 1997 <br /> Paue 1 wl <br /> petroleum hydrocarbon concentration in the influent stream reached an asymptotic <br /> condition_ <br /> The composition of the residual hydrocarbons in soils is characterized by the presence of <br /> the relatively high molecular weight compounds. TPPH concentrations range in <br /> concentration from less than 10 to 10,000 ppm. Benzene with few exceptions has not <br /> been detected. <br /> Residual hydrocarbons dissolved in groundwater are primarily affected by: <br /> (1) hydrocarbon-impacted vadose-zone soils typical of source areas, (2) residual hvdro- <br /> carbons left in soil by groundwater fluctuation, (1) operation of the SVE system: and <br /> (4)intrinsic remediation (mechanisms including biodegradation, chemical oxidation, and <br /> adsorptioniabsorption). Dissolved hydrocarbon concentrations in groundwater samples <br /> collected from Well MW-4, located in the source area. have significantly decreased with <br /> the overall increase in groundwater elevation. This trend indicates that SVE was <br /> effective in remediating hydrocarbon-impacted soils in the source area. <br /> Groundwater samples collected between July 1993 and January 1996 from Well MW-13 <br /> were representative of actual groundwater conditions. Throughout this period, <br /> contaminant concentrations varied between non-detect to 38 ppb for benzene and <br /> non-detect to 3,400 ppb for TPPH-a. More recent measurements at this well (with <br /> submerged screen conditions) demonstrate the same variability. Throughout these <br /> concentration variations, there have been no discernible trends indicating any increase. <br /> As such, the data demonstrates that the contaminant plume is stable(not migrating) and <br /> it can be inferred that the total extent is not much further beyond Well MW-13. <br /> No detectable concentrations TPPH-g or benzene have been reported from downgradi- <br /> ent Wells MW-11, MW-12, or MW-14 for at minimum five consecutive quarters,there- <br /> fore the wells define the extent of petroleum hydrocarbons in groundwater. , <br /> MtBE has been detected in Well MW-9 and confirmed. Groundwater monitoring <br /> indicates that MtBE is lir sited to one well and is defined to non-detectable concentra- <br /> tions.
